18年石油大学《Visual FoxPro》第2阶段在线作业.docx
《18年石油大学《Visual FoxPro》第2阶段在线作业.docx》由会员分享,可在线阅读,更多相关《18年石油大学《Visual FoxPro》第2阶段在线作业.docx(16页珍藏版)》请在冰豆网上搜索。
18年石油大学《VisualFoxPro》第2阶段在线作业
答题要求:
每题只有一个正确的选项。
1(5.0分)
设表文件“学生.DBF”中有10条记录,执行如下两条命令:
USE 学生INSERT BLANK其结果是在学生表文件的()
A)
第1条记录的位置插入了1个空白记录
B)
第2条记录的位置插入了1个空白记录
C)
文件尾插入了1个空白记录
D)
不确定位置插入了1个空白记录
参考答案:
B
收起解析
解析:
无
2(5.0分)
已知基本表SC(S#,C#,GRADE),则“统计选修了课程的学生人次数”的SQL语句为()
A)
SELECTCOUNT(DISTINCTS#)FROMSC
B)
SELECTCOUNT(DISTINCTC#)FROMSC
C)
SELECTCOUNT(*)FROMSC
D)
SELECTCOUNT(DISTINCT*)FROMSC
参考答案:
C
收起解析
解析:
无
3(5.0分)
以下关于空值(NULL)的叙述正确的是()
A)
空值等同于数值0
B)
VisualFoxPro不支持NULL
C)
空值等同于空字符串
D)
NULL表示字段或变量还没有确定值
参考答案:
D
收起解析
解析:
无
4(5.0分)
要为当前表所有职工增加100元工资,应该使用命令()
A)
CHANGE 工资 WITH 工资+100
B)
REPLACE工资 WITH 工资+100
C)
CHANGE ALL 工资 WITH 工资+100
D)
REPLACEALL 工资 WITH 工资+100
参考答案:
D
收起解析
解析:
无
5(5.0分)
VF的应用程序由三种基本结构组合而成,它们是()
A)
顺序结构、选择结构和循环结构
B)
顺序结构、循环结构和模块结构
C)
逻辑结构、物理结构和程序结构
D)
分支结构、重复结构和子程序结构
参考答案:
A
收起解析
解析:
无
6(5.0分)
使用DLSPLAY命令时,若范围短语为ALL或REST,执行命令后,记录指针指为()
A)
首记录
B)
末记录
C)
首记录的前面
D)
末记录的后面
参考答案:
D
收起解析
解析:
无
7(5.0分)
在VisualFoxPro中表单(Form)是()
A)
数据库中表的清单
B)
一个表中记录的清单
C)
数据库中可以查询的对象清单
D)
窗口界面
参考答案:
D
收起解析
解析:
无
8(5.0分)
检索所有比“王华”年龄大的学生姓名、年龄和性别。
正确的SELECT语句是()
A)
SELECTSN,AGE,SEXFROMS
WHEREAGE>(SELECTAGEFROMS
WHERESN=′王华′)
B)
SELECTSN,AGE,SEXFROMS
WHERESN=′王华′
C)
SELECTSN,AGE,SEXFROMS
WHEREAGE>(SELECTAGEWHERESN=′王华′)
D)
SELECTSN,AGE,SEXFROMS
WHEREAGE>王华
参考答案:
A
收起解析
解析:
无
9(5.0分)
假定学生关系是S(S#,SNAME,SEX,AGE),课程关系是C(C#,CNAME,TEACHER),学生选课关系是SC(S#,C#,GRADE)。
要查找选修“COMPUTER”课程的“女”学生姓名,将涉及到关系()
A)
S
B)
SC,C
C)
S,SC
D)
S,C,SC
参考答案:
D
收起解析
解析:
无
10(5.0分)
假定表文件ABC.DBF前6条记录均为男生记录,执行以下命令后,记录指针定位在()USE ABCGO 3LOCATE NEXT 3 FOR性别="男"
A)
第3号记录上
B)
第4号记录上
C)
第5号记录上
D)
第6号记录上
参考答案:
A
收起解析
解析:
无
11(5.0分)
若某一个扩展名为.DBF的文件有3个备注型字段,则该文件对应的备注文件有()
A)
3个
B)
1个
C)
4个
D)
0个
参考答案:
B
收起解析
解析:
无
12(5.0分)
当两张表进行无条件连接时,交叉组合后形成的新记录个数是()
A)
两张表记录数之差
B)
两张表记录数之和
C)
两张表中记录多者的记录数
D)
两张表记录数的乘积
参考答案:
D
收起解析
解析:
无
13(5.0分)
在Visual FoxPro中,关于视图的描述正确的是()
A)
视图是从一个或多个数据库表导出的虚拟表
B)
视图与数据库表相同,用来存储数据
C)
视图不能同数据库表进行连接操作
D)
在视图上不能进行更新操作
参考答案:
A
收起解析
解析:
无
14(5.0分)
连编后可以脱离开Visual FoxPro独立运行的程序是()
A)
PRG程序
B)
EXE程序
C)
FXP程序
D)
APP程序
参考答案:
B
收起解析
解析:
无
15(5.0分)
This是对()的引用。
A)
当前对象
B)
当前表单
C)
任意对象
D)
任意表单
参考答案:
A
收起解析
解析:
无
16(5.0分)
SQLSELECT语句完成的是()
A)
选择操作
B)
查询操作
C)
修改操作
D)
连接操作
参考答案:
B
收起解析
解析:
无
17(5.0分)
SQL是哪几个英语单词的缩写()
A)
StandardQueryLanguage
B)
StructuredQueryLanguage
C)
SelectQueryLanguage
D)
其他三项都不是
参考答案:
B
收起解析
解析:
无
18(5.0分)
检索选修四门以上课程的学生总成绩(不统计不及格的课程),并要求按总成绩的降序排列出来。
正确的SELECT语句是()
A)
SELECTS#,SUM(GRADE)FROMSC
WHEREGRADE>=60
GROUPBYS#
ORDERBY2DESC
HAVINGCOUNT(*)>=4
B)
SELECTS#,SUM(GRADE)FROMSC
WHEREGRADE>=60
GROUPBYS#
HAVINGCOUNT(*)>=4
ORDERBY2DESC
C)
SELECTS#,SUM(GRADE)FROMSC
WHEREGRADE>=60
HAVINGCOUNT(*)>=4
GROUPBYS#
ORDERBY2DESC
D)
DELECTS#,SUM(GRADE)FROMSC
WHEREGRADE>=60
ORDERBY2DESC
GROUPBYS#
HAVINGCOUNT(*)>=4
参考答案:
B
收起解析
解析:
无
19(5.0分)
UPDATE语句的功能是()
A)
数据定义功能
B)
数据查询功能
C)
可以修改表中某些列的属性
D)
可以修改表中某些列的内容
参考答案:
D
收起解析
解析:
无
20(5.0分)
在VisualFoxPro中存储图像的字段类型应该是()
A)
字符型
B)
通用型
C)
备注型
D)
双精度型
参考答案:
B
收起解析
解析:
无